TRUSTEE, Semi-Retired Partner at Praxis Properties, Board of Trustees
Bill is honored to return to the AAACF Board after previously serving as Chair many years ago. He believes the Foundation plays a vital role in strengthening the community, and its mission to be a force For Good. For Ever. For All. has long inspired the generosity and trust of its donors, supporters, and community partners.
After coming to Ann Arbor for graduate school at the University of Michigan, where he earned advanced degrees in mathematics and engineering, Bill pursued a career in the "built world." He founded Phoenix Contractors, a commercial construction company, and Praxis Properties, a development company. Today, he remains a partner in both businesses during his semi-retirement while his son leads their day-to-day operations.
Bill has been actively involved with numerous nonprofit organizations throughout the community, with a continuing focus on Riverside Arts Center, The Ark, the Huron River Watershed Council, SOS Community Services, and many others. He is passionate about supporting the arts, music, environmental stewardship, and social services - causes that are also deeply valued by many AAACF donors. Bill is committed to helping expand the Foundation's impact and philanthropic reach and is honored to contribute to its continued growth and success.
